Yassir is the leading super App in the Maghreb region set to changing the way daily services are provided. It currently operates in 45 cities across Algeria, Morocco and Tunisia with recent expansions into France, Canada and Sub-Saharan Africa. It is backed (~$200M in funding) by VCs from Silicon Valley, Europe and other parts of the world.
We offer on-demand services such as ride-hailing and last-mile delivery. Building on this infrastructure, we are now introducing financial services to help our users pay, save and borrow digitally.

Responsibilities

    • Analyze customer, transaction, merchant, and agent data to identify trends, opportunities, and performance drivers across Wallets, Payments, Bill Payments, Merchant Payments, P2P Transfers, and other Financial Services products.

    • Partner with Product Managers, Operations, Risk, Finance, and Engineering teams to answer business questions through data and support product decision-making.

    • Develop and maintain dashboards, reports, and KPI tracking frameworks to monitor customer growth, engagement, retention, transaction performance, and revenue metrics.

    • Conduct deep-dive analyses on customer behavior, payment funnels, wallet activation, transaction success rates, merchant activity, and agent performance.

    • Support product discovery and feature development by identifying customer pain points, behavioral patterns, and growth opportunities using data.

    • Design, execute, and evaluate A/B tests, feature launches, promotional campaigns, and product experiments to measure impact and guide future improvements.

    • Work closely with Data Science and Risk teams to support customer segmentation, fraud monitoring, credit risk analysis, and predictive modeling initiatives.

    • Perform exploratory data analysis (EDA) to uncover actionable insights and support the development of data-driven product enhancements.

    • Monitor data quality, identify anomalies, and collaborate with Data Engineering teams to improve tracking, instrumentation, and reporting accuracy.

    • Communicate findings and recommendations clearly to both technical and non-technical stakeholders through presentations, reports, and dashboards.

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
